摘要
Worldwide multi-terminal or even meshed HVDC systems are expected to be a suitable solution for upcoming challenges within the energy transmission sector. During the last years several methods have been proposed to control such kind of HVDC systems with local DC node voltage control characteristics. These are all piecewise linear characteristics. This paper proposes a continuous control characteristic including guidelines for its parameterization in order to 1) represent existing method's proven advantages and 2) to avoid a critical stress of the AC grid surrounding the converter stations in case of DC voltage control actions.
